The station was opened as Shin-Yawata Station.

Hachiman Station was abolished and merged with this station.

Within the year, the station structure was changed from the previous 2-side platform 2-track relative style to the current 1-island platform 2-track style.

A collision between a train and a truck occurred at the manual first level crossing in the station premises, resulting in 2 deaths and 3 injuries, caused by the crossing guard oversleeping and neglecting to operate the opening and closing device.

The original station structure was an staggered relative platform with the down platform roughly in its current position and the up platform located closer to Funabashi, but after the war, the up platform was relocated to match the position of the down platform.
